3 Schools Announce They’re Withdrawing From Conference USA In anticipation of a move to the Sun Belt Conference, three schools — Old Dominion, Marshall and Southern Miss — have all announced their decision to end their alliance with Conference USA in June 2022. Sports Illustrated’s college football insider Ross Dellenger reports that this decision comes in response to all three of these schools being included on the official C-USA fall schedule that was released earlier this week. The Sun Belt has also included each of these three schools in their scheduling for the 2022 season, Dellenger adds. .

The Zips open the season a little later than last year, traveling to Nashville for a 3 game weekend series against Lipscomb. The Bisons were 8-13 (18-29) finishing 6th in the D1 Atlantic Sun Conference. The ASC is not a baseball powerhouse so this should be a good warmup series before facing Georgia and Louisville. Theres quite a few additions to the roster this year, with not many players leaving. A refreshing change from Season One where a coach went rogue and took his favorite players with him. All systems are “go” so far for having a 2022 MAC Baseball Tournament for the first time in two years. CMU was the last tournament champion. The latest I heard today on ESPNU Radio on Sirius today, don't look for expansion of the playoffs anytime soon. There was an agreement for a 12 or 16 team playoff that "everyone" agreed on, but when the teams starting jumping conferences, it fell apart. Now the conferences want to be sure they will have a place in the bracket, while the SEC wants all of their highly ranked teams in. Whether or not all of the P5 conferences are represented. So they're staying with the status quo for the next several years.
